The Effect of Puppet Show on Pain and Fear During Subcutaneous Injection in Children With Leukemia
Lead Sponsor:
Dokuz Eylul University
Collaborating Sponsors:
Ege University
Conditions:
Pain, Acute
Fear
Eligibility:
All Genders
3-7 years
Phase:
NA
Brief Summary
This study aim to evaluate the effect of puppet show applied during subcutaneous injection to children aged 3-7 years with leukemia on the level of pain and fear experienced by children due to the int...
